What to do if you have painful sex after menopause

We all know that women's menopause means that their reproductive ability has disappeared, but they still have sexual excitement. However, some couples will find that when they have sex, women's lower body will cause pain, but many people don't know how to deal with it. In fact, if women have lower body pain during sex after menopause, it can be solved by applying lubricant.

When women reach a certain age, their body's growth hormone metabolism may become lower and lower, and many women will experience menopause. But what we can also understand is that women still have sexual excitement after menopause. However, many women will find that they feel pain when having sex with their husbands after menopause, but this pain is very mild, so many people want to know how to deal with it.

In fact, menopause is a normal physiological phenomenon for every woman. Menopause only means that their reproductive function disappears from now on. And because what controls whether a woman has her period is the amount of estrogen in her body, we know that when a woman's estrogen level decreases, her vaginal mucus secretions may also decrease during sexual intercourse. This mucus has a lubricating effect during sexual intercourse. Therefore, many women who have already gone through menopause will find that they feel pain during sexual intercourse after menopause. In fact, this phenomenon is very common in many women, so every woman does not need to be afraid of postmenopausal sex life because of the occurrence of this phenomenon.

In fact, there are many ways to deal with the problem of postmenopausal sexual pain. The most common one that comes to mind is lubricant. We all know that applying appropriate lubricant can effectively reduce the pain of women during sex. Another way is to ask your lover to do foreplay before having sex. Because the ability of women after menopause to secrete love fluid is reduced, only sufficient foreplay can ensure that their lower body is sufficiently moist. If the above method has no effect, the woman still needs to go to the hospital to check whether she has any gynecological diseases caused by menopause.
